ARRIVALS

ARRIVING AT THE AIRPORT

When you arrive in the UK, the UK Border Force officers at the airport will ask you to show your passport. All Student visas are now stored electronically and you may be asked to provide the officer with a Share Code. This is so that you can evidence that you understand how to access your visa information.

PASSING THROUGH BORDER CONTROL

A Border Force officer will check your passport and may ask to see your tickets/ boarding card. So make sure you have everything you need in your hand luggage (refer to the list on page 13). They may ask you some questions, such as why you are coming to the UK to study or what your future plans are. Make sure you have hard copies of all your important documents and do not rely on digital versions. Once you have cleared immigration, you can collect your baggage.

CUSTOMS AND BAGGAGE CHECKS

After collecting your baggage, you must walk through the customs area to leave the airport. • If you have nothing to declare, you can pass through the green channel. • If you have goods to declare, you must pass through the red channel. Customs officers can ask to inspect your baggage. If they make this request,

you must co-operate. You can read more on UK customs at www.gov.uk/government/publications/travelling-to-the-uk
